Button warns Vandoorne about 2017 McLaren challenge

Jenson Button has warned his McLaren replacement Stoffel Vandoorne about the potential challenges the Belgian driver is likely to face as a McLaren driver.  At the Italian Grand Prix, Jenson Button announced he would be stepping down as a full-time McLaren Formula One driver, and subsequently McLaren announced Vandoorne will partner Alonso during the 2017 season. Vandoorne has key experience in the field of single-seater motorsports — the Belgian driver was the 2015 GP2 world champion, and along with his McLaren reserve driver role, Vandoorne currently races in Super Formula.
